Skip to content

Commit 3bd9ca8

Browse files
Fix takeScreenshot flow for screenshot-capable offline models
1 parent 9652f6e commit 3bd9ca8

1 file changed

Lines changed: 2 additions & 2 deletions

File tree

app/src/main/kotlin/com/google/ai/sample/ScreenOperatorAccessibilityService.kt

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-234,8 +234,8 @@ class ScreenOperatorAccessibilityService : AccessibilityService() {
234234
}
235235
is Command.TakeScreenshot -> {
236236
val currentModel = GenerativeAiViewModelFactory.getCurrentModel()
237-
if (currentModel.isOfflineModel) {
238-
Log.d(TAG, "Command.TakeScreenshot: Model is offline, capturing screen info only.")
237+
if (!currentModel.supportsScreenshot) {
238+
Log.d(TAG, "Command.TakeScreenshot: Model has no screenshot support, capturing screen info only.")
239239
this.showToast("Capturing screen info...", false)
240240
val screenInfo = captureScreenInformation()
241241
val mainActivity = MainActivity.getInstance()

0 commit comments

Comments
 (0)